2012年度CTBT放射性核素实验室滤材样品能力验证

DOI: 10.11889/j.0253-3219.2015.hjs.38.030502, PP. 30502-30502

Keywords: 全面禁止核试验条约,滤材样品,能力验证,活度,零时

Full-Text   Cite this paper   Add to My Lib

Abstract:

为检验核素实验室对大气颗粒物滤材样品中放射性核素的分析能力,全面禁止核试验条约筹委会临时技术秘书处从2000年开始每年组织一次能力验证活动。2012年度核素实验室能力验证活动中,参考样品中添加了24种放射性核素(其中主要核素11种,次要核素13种),北京放射性核素实验室使用相对效率为76%的HPGe?谱仪系统完成了样品的测量分析,准确识别出了11种主要核素和12种次要核素,主要核素活度测量结果准确,由95Nb/95Zr活度比推算的零时与参考值之间相差仅0.03d。
